What does MCB stand for in the context of door and whistle systems?

In the context of door and whistle systems, MCB stands for Miniature Circuit Breaker. This component is crucial for electrical safety and circuit protection. A Miniature Circuit Breaker is designed to automatically switch off electrical circuits when it detects an overload or a short circuit, thereby protecting the wiring and equipment from damage.

Using a Miniature Circuit Breaker in door and whistle systems is beneficial because it helps to prevent electrical fires and malfunctions caused by excessive current flow. By providing a reliable means to interrupt the electrical circuit under fault conditions, the MCB enhances the overall safety and operability of the system, ensuring that components like motors and signaling devices are protected.
